The next morning they arrived at Michael's house around 10:00. Their plan had been to get there a little earlier to have breakfast with his brothers. Since both brothers are early risers, they had probably already eaten.
Alisa turned around as Michael closed the front door. "I don't hear any movement. Maybe they're still asleep."
Michael wrapped his arms around her waist. Alisa was looking very sexy this morning in a pair tight jeans and silk blouse with a black leather jacket. Michael looked down at her. "I suppose it's possible, but they don't normally sleep this late.
Michael wiggled his eyebrows suggestively. “We could go upstairs and relax until they wake up. I have this huge comfortable bed and my room is far enough away from the others so we wouldn't be disturbed."
Alisa looked at him suspiciously. "Hmm. Relax indeed. I am not going to your room with your brothers here. Besides, you promised to feed me," she pouted.
Michael leaned down and kissed the corner of her mouth. "I bet I could persuade you to change your mind." He ran his hands up and down her hips. "Your body wants me. I bet your nipples are swelling in anticipation." He nibbled on her ear.
Alisa melted in his arms. "Ah. You are so wrong. You know I can't resist you when you do that."
He crushed her in his arms, his lips devouring hers in a heated kiss. It wasn't until he heard someone clear their throat that he came up for air.
Monte chuckled at the way Michael was practically eating the woman alive. "I hate to interrupt, but perhaps you should take her upstairs before you strip her naked right here in the foyer."
Michael looked up at a smirking Monte, holding a steaming cup of coffee in his hand. "How long have you been standing there?"
"Long enough to know that last night’s misunderstanding has been resolved. I bet she hasn't had breakfast yet."
Michael still had his arm around her waist. "Baby, the comedian over there is my brother, Monte."
Alisa felt like a naughty teen again caught kissing by her parents. Like Michael and Marcus, Monte was a very handsome man. She was sure women of all races threw themselves at him all across the globe.
"It's nice to meet you, Monte. I've heard so much about you and your travels."
Monte walked forward and took her hand. "It's always nice to meet a beautiful woman."
Michael rolled his eyes at that comment. "Your attempt at flattery is wasted on her. She's not interested. Save it for your next conquest, Monte."
"It's not flattery when speaking the truth, big brother." Monte looked at Alisa. "I made breakfast." He nodded his head in Michael's direction. "He can eat if he wants."
Alisa giggled at their playful remarks towards each other. "I don't smell any food."
Monte looked pointedly at Michael. "It doesn’t surprise me since you were practically mauled the minute you walked through the door." He took Alisa’s arm and walked with her into the kitchen with Michael trailing behind, shaking his head.
